(04-02-2017 05:57 AM)emu steve Wrote:  Just a quick note on recruiting 'timeline'.

Coaches, including Murphy (he Tweeted) are in Phoenix for the NCAA Final Four. After the coaches return home there will be about a week (April 12) before the beginning of the spring signing period.

There are still a fairly large number of good unsigned MI h.s. players as well as JUCOs and transfers. Good time to have a free scholarship or two...

Some of the best MI h.s. uncommitted seniors are:

Gregory Elliott, Jermaine Jackson Jr., Jack Ballantyne, Eric Williams, Darian Owens-White.

I believe Eric Williams has moved up in the rankings (as did Ellison who committed this past week to EMU).

Owens-White could be D-I or II. I know little about Ballantyne other than he is a solid, mid-major '4' prospect (offered a few days ago by Duquesne) and holds a number of offers.
EMU has plenty of PGs, SGs,and SFs, already. They could use another 4 or 5 though. I say Murphy should only go after a young big unless an elite talent at another position falls in his lap. That or just keep the open schollie.
